2010-08-14 9 views
0

J'ai utilisé des données de base dans mes applications. Mon application fonctionne bien en mode en ligne et hors ligne. J'ai des doutes sur, comment écrire une requête dans les données de base (SQLite similaire). J'ai écrit une requête et utilisé dans SQLite. Mais je veux savoir, comment écrire une requête (sélectionner, insérer, mettre à jour, etc.) en utilisant des données de base.Comment écrire une requête dans Core Data dans iPhone

Veuillez me guider et me donner quelques liens utiles.

Répondre

3

Vous devriez lire par Apple's tutorial on Core Data. Il passe par le processus de fabrication d'une application très simple qui utilise des données de base. Pour les requêtes plus complexes, vous devrez créer un predicate pour restreindre les valeurs renvoyées.

1

Je pense que vous ne pouvez pas écrire SQL comme requête (sélectionner, insérer, mettre à jour ...), vous devez plutôt utiliser des objets NSPredicate. Qui supportent ce type d'opération à sa manière.

1

Vous pouvez utiliser un prédicat lors de l'extraction de données. Pour plus d'informations, visit here